Senator Square: Carson High senior projects are more than a graduation requirement

Raynna Jackson began helping with Toys for Tots at the Ron Wood center before Thanksgiving in order to fulfill her CHS Senior Project graduation requirement; she decided to help give underprivileged children a Merry Christmas.

She started by putting boxes at CHS and her mother’s place of employment, Natel Company. Toys for Tots serves more than 2,000 Carson City area kids every Christmas, and Raynna took this personally; she wanted to help bring in even more gifts. Raynna ultimately facilitated the gathering of 2 large boxes of toys.

Happy Nevada Day

A little good humor on Nevada's 152nd birthday.

Did you know that Nevada became the 36th state admitted to the Union entirely by telegraph?
